"This handsome halls adjoining 1940s semi-detached family house offers spacious, well-designed accommodation and is located on a very popular cul-de-sac just off Fallodon Way, which offers great access to Henleaze School, Waitrose and Henleaze Shops. Recent works carried out to the property include a refurbished roof within the last 2 years, a recently fitted boiler, many replacement windows and the kitchen has been opened into the dining room creating an open plan family space. Parts of the property have been prepared for redecoration and the old kitchen and bathroom have been removed. This property will now make an ideal project for those who want to create a lovely home to their own taste and specifications. Accommodation comprises; 3 good bedrooms, spacious 16' sitting room, bathroom

(requires fitting out) open plan kitchen/ dining room

(requires fitting out). Outside is a pleasant garden that backs onto open space as well as a detached garage. The property is offered with no onward chain!_
